The Content Acquisition (CA) team is an integral part of the Data department. We are responsible for managing, acquiring, and integrating content and data from Exchanges, brokers, sell-side, buy-side, and other types of providers to drive the value of the Bloomberg Terminal and downstream enterprise products. We lead the governance, cost, and quality of the data we acquire, and we collaborate with the wider company to develop our data acquisition strategies ensuring we are aligning with the agendas of our key partners.

The Role:

Within CA, the Exchanges & Data Model team supports over 350 trading venues globally and is constantly looking to improve our technical capabilities to effectively manage our market-leading Exchange content. We have an exciting opportunity for an individual to join the team as a Technical Account Manager (TAM), based in the London office.

Technical Account Managers work closely with a variety of departments across Bloomberg - including Engineering, Sales, Product, Networks, and Enterprise Solutions – as well as the Exchanges themselves, to ensure the successful delivery of real-time Exchange data on Bloomberg customers. Technical Account Managers are required to lead multiple projects simultaneously and manage competing responsibilities such as creating comprehensive business requirements, conducting analysis, interpreting new Exchange announcements, and facilitating and testing product releases. We will trust you to:

  • Handle all technical aspects of real-time market-data related projects. These could be driven either by the Exchange or Bloomberg, aimed at enhancing the existing market-data setup or adding new data and/or products;

  • Ensure the successful delivery of Exchange products to Bloomberg customers by meeting non-negotiable deadlines;

  • Manage relationships and coordinate projects with customers and the Exchange, including calls/visits as needed;

  • Prioritize projects and manage expectations to both our internal and external partners;

  • Act as the subject matter specialist for the technologies Exchanges utilize to deliver data to vendors, and for the technical specifications set out by the Exchange to assess the impact of changes;

  • Be the conduit between the Business and Engineering by interpreting business needs into project requirements, and effectively communicating these;

  • Collaborate closely with the Data Model (DM) team to ensure adherence to Bloomberg Data Model standards for the movement and transformation of market data through Bloomberg’s Feeds Infrastructure;

  • Collaborate with the DM team to have new DM features designed/released;

  • Translate Exchange documentation and technical specifications into business deliverables for new exchange data on Bloomberg;

  • Conduct testing both pre-production and post-release;

  • Effectively run projects end-to-end, from requirements gathering to post-production release and stakeholder communication management;

  • Function as the overall escalation point for any issues with exchange market data;

  • Thrive on building innovative solutions to sophisticated problems.
